Everton are likely to be in the race to sign Man United midfielder Scott McTominay this summer, sources told Football Insider.
Football Insider revealed last month (26 May) that McTominay, 26, has told friends he wants to leave Old Trafford this summer for the good of his career.
It is believed the Red Devils are ready to listen to offers for the Scotland international following his limited involvement in the 2022-23 campaign.
Everton have been widely linked with McTominay as Sean Dyche attempts to reinforce his squad after escaping relegation to the Championship.
West Ham and Newcastle are also reportedly interested in the midfielder.
A well-placed source has revealed a permanent swoop for McTominay would cost “in excess of £20million” – which would make it “very hard” for Everton to complete.
It is believed the Merseysiders would be outsiders in any race for his signature due to their financial situation.
Football Insider revealed last month (22 May) that Everton will have no money to play with in this summer’s transfer market.
However, one route to landing McTominay could be through player sales in the off-season.
Sources told Football Insider last month (23 May) that Everton are willing to sell midfielder Amadou Onana for £60million amid interest from Man United and other Premier League clubs.
McTominay made 39 appearances across all competitions in the 2022-23 campaign – but managed only 16 starts in those outings.
He has amassed 144 Premier League appearances since coming through the ranks at Old Trafford.
